Abstract:
In order to verify the tensile strength of the steel cable for aeroengine test, it is necessary to conduct the tensile test of cable. Due to the adverse impact of the cable break, it is necessary to study the safety guarantee technology in the cable tensile test. By analyzing the control principle of the cable tensile test and the control parameters that affect the safety of the test during the control process, the setting of each parameter and the corresponding inspection and protection mechanism are summarized, which has a directive function for the safety implementation of the cable tensile test and can be applied to other structure strength tests.
